you need a llvm/test/CodeGen/DirectX/isnan.ll
You can use llvm/test/CodeGen/DirectX/isinf.ll as a reference.

The one difference I would do is:

; RUN: opt -S -dxil-intrinsic-expansion -scalarizer -dxil-op-lower -mtriple=dxil-pc-shadermodel6.9-library %s | FileCheck %s --check-prefixes=CHECK,SM69CHECK
; RUN: opt -S -dxil-intrinsic-expansion -mtriple=dxil-pc-shadermodel6.8-library %s | FileCheck %s --check-prefixes=CHECK,SMOLDCHECK

We are already testing fp16 scalarization of the emulated codegen via llvm/test/CodeGen/DirectX/is_fpclass.ll we don't need to do it as part of this test. As such we don't need DXIL lowering for the SM 6.8 case either we just need to know that for fp32 the intrinsic is preserved and for fp16 it gets emulated. the DXIL lowering can be limited to the SM 6.9 case.
